Ssd raid 0最佳化
SSD(固態硬碟)RAID 0是一種通過將多個SSD組合在一起來提高存儲性能的技術。RAID 0通過條帶化數據,將數據分布在多個磁碟中,從而提供更高的讀寫速度。然而,由於RAID 0沒有數據冗餘,一旦一個磁碟發生故障,整個陣列的數據都會丟失,因此它通常用於對數據安全性要求不高,但需要高性能的環境中。
為了最大化SSD RAID 0的性能,以下是一些最佳實踐:
-
使用高質量的SSD:選擇可靠的品牌和型號,確保SSD具有良好的性能和耐用性。
-
使用最新的固件:確保所有SSD都安裝了最新的固件,這樣可以提高性能並修復潛在的錯誤。
-
使用同一型號的SSD:如果可能,使用同一型號甚至同一批次生產的SSD,這樣可以減少潛在的性能差異和兼容性問題。
-
使用合適的RAID控制器:確保你的RAID控制器支持SSD最佳化功能,如TRIM和NCQ(Native Command Queuing)。
-
啟用TRIM:TRIM是一種命令,可以告訴SSD哪些數據塊是空的,這樣SSD就可以在後台回收這些塊,提高性能。在大多數現代作業系統中,TRIM是自動啟用的。
-
啟用NCQ:NCQ允許SSD以更有效的方式處理命令佇列,減少延遲並提高性能。
-
使用RAID 0的正確大小:確保你的RAID 0大小是SSD容量的整數倍,這樣可以最大限度地利用SSD的性能。
-
避免碎片化:由於SSD的寫入性能會隨著分區中的碎片化增加而降低,因此定期使用碎片整理工具可以幫助提高性能。
-
使用合適的檔案系統:選擇支持SSD特性的檔案系統,如NTFS(Windows)或ext4(Linux)。
-
監控健康狀況:定期監控SSD的健康狀況,包括SMART(Self-Monitoring, Analysis and Reporting Technology)屬性,以確保它們沒有出現任何問題。
-
避免寫入密集型工作負載:由於RAID 0沒有數據冗餘,頻繁的寫入操作可能會縮短SSD的壽命。
-
考慮使用RAID 1或RAID 5:如果你的數據安全性要求較高,可以考慮使用RAID 1(鏡像)或RAID 5(奇偶校驗)來提供數據冗餘。
-
最佳化寫入策略:如果你的SSD支持寫入策略最佳化,如寫入均衡(Wear Leveling)或垃圾收集(Garbage Collection),確保這些功能已啟用。
-
使用合適的驅動器接口:如果可能,使用PCIe NVMe SSD,因為它們通常比SATA SSD提供更高的性能。
-
最佳化系統設定:確保你的作業系統和應用程式配置得當,以充分利用SSD RAID 0的性能。
請記住,RAID 0是一種高風險、高回報的配置。雖然它可以提供卓越的性能,但一旦發生磁碟故障,數據將無法恢復。因此,在部署SSD RAID 0之前,務必備份重要的數據。